The Senior RBT/ Mid-Level Supervisor/ BCaBA role involves providing direct oversight of client programming, supervising Behavior Technicians and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s), collaborating with families and other providers. The ideal candidate brings clinical expertise, leadership initiative, and a commitment to evidence-based, trauma-informed care.
Note: All mid-level case supervision is expected to be completed either in person at the EBC Center located at 20 Dewitt Avenue, Clovis, in the client’s home, or via tele-health, depending on client needs and program requirements.
Work Expectations: This full-time position averages 40 hours per week. Employees are expected to maintain an average of 120 billable hours per month, with the remaining time dedicated to supervision, training, documentation, meetings, and administrative responsibilities.
Key Responsibilities
● Assist with conducting skills assessments and Functional Behavior Assessments (FBAs); contribute to individualized treatment plans.
● Implement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) therapy directly in-home, at school, or in clinic/community settings.
● Monitor client progress and make data-driven treatment adjustments.
● Ensure all clinical documentation meets ethical, legal, and funding-source standards.
● Participate in team case reviews and clinical development projects.
● Support BCBAs and clinical staff in client-related work across environments.
